Décimaux en hexadécimale
31 posts
• Page 2 of 4 • 1, 2, 3, 4
Re: Décimaux en hexadécimale
Bon allez je simplifie :
Si ton nombre est positif tu met comme bits de poids fort(MSB) 0 sinon 1
Puis ton nombre en binaire tu l'écris en scientifique 1.xxxxx*2^y
tu fais y + 127 et t'écris ça en binaire sur 8 bits
Tu met xxxxx que tu complete avec des 0 pour avoir 23 bits
Pour finir tu concatene le tout : 0(y+127)2xxxxx00000000000000000000000
Si ton nombre est positif tu met comme bits de poids fort(MSB) 0 sinon 1
Puis ton nombre en binaire tu l'écris en scientifique 1.xxxxx*2^y
tu fais y + 127 et t'écris ça en binaire sur 8 bits
Tu met xxxxx que tu complete avec des 0 pour avoir 23 bits
Pour finir tu concatene le tout : 0(y+127)2xxxxx00000000000000000000000
-
chicu
Niveau 8: ER (Espèce Rare: nerd)- Posts: 206
- Joined: 27 May 2007, 00:00
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: TS SI
Re: Décimaux en hexadécimale
vala c'est plus clair là 

`echo "ZWNobyAncm0gLXJmIC4gaGFoYWhhIDpEJwo=" | base64 -d`
Pas de support par MP, merci.
Pas de support par MP, merci.
-
tama
Niveau 14: CI (Calculateur de l'Infini)- Posts: 10995
- Joined: 19 Dec 2005, 00:00
- Location: /dev/null mais je survis :)
- Gender:
- Calculator(s):→ MyCalcs profile
Re: Décimaux en hexadécimale
POur le signe, je connaissais, mais (sauf si j'ai mal compris), ta façon de convertir ne convertit pas les nombres décimaux ... Seulement les relatifs.
-
Ver2guerre
Niveau 12: CP (Calculatrice sur Pattes)- Posts: 2473
- Joined: 29 Sep 2006, 00:00
- Location: Le plus loin possible des casio
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: boup
Re: Décimaux en hexadécimale
1. C'est quoi le poid(s?) d'un bit?
2. Comment peux-tu nous donner ^2en binaire?
2. Comment peux-tu nous donner ^2en binaire?
-
ProgVal
Niveau 12: CP (Calculatrice sur Pattes)- Posts: 2747
- Joined: 05 Jul 2007, 00:00
- Location: Metz
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: Terminale S SI (Sciences de l'Ingénieur)
Re: Décimaux en hexadécimale
j'ai ton adresse ver2guerre o moins ?
-
ced78fr
Niveau 13: CU (Calculateur Universel)- Posts: 3845
- Joined: 11 May 2006, 00:00
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: Bac +5
-
ProgVal
Niveau 12: CP (Calculatrice sur Pattes)- Posts: 2747
- Joined: 05 Jul 2007, 00:00
- Location: Metz
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: Terminale S SI (Sciences de l'Ingénieur)
Re: Décimaux en hexadécimale
1. C'est quoi le poid(s?) d'un bit?
2. Comment peux-tu nous donner ^2en binaire?
1.Je saurais pas expliquer clairement, mais un bit a un poids
le bit le plus fort est celui le plus à gauche (MSB, most significant byte) et le plus faible à droite (LSB, less significant byte)
par exemple, dans 256 :
(100000000)(2)
en rouge, le MSB
en bleu, le LSB
Après je laisse Charognard compléter/corriger tout ça
2.Ca veut rien dire ^2
2. Comment peux-tu nous donner ^2en binaire?
1.Je saurais pas expliquer clairement, mais un bit a un poids
le bit le plus fort est celui le plus à gauche (MSB, most significant byte) et le plus faible à droite (LSB, less significant byte)
par exemple, dans 256 :
(100000000)(2)
en rouge, le MSB
en bleu, le LSB
Après je laisse Charognard compléter/corriger tout ça
2.Ca veut rien dire ^2
`echo "ZWNobyAncm0gLXJmIC4gaGFoYWhhIDpEJwo=" | base64 -d`
Pas de support par MP, merci.
Pas de support par MP, merci.
-
tama
Niveau 14: CI (Calculateur de l'Infini)- Posts: 10995
- Joined: 19 Dec 2005, 00:00
- Location: /dev/null mais je survis :)
- Gender:
- Calculator(s):→ MyCalcs profile
Re: Décimaux en hexadécimale
je rajouterais simplement que le poids du bit
est donné par la position du bit en partant de la droite
par exemple dans 00000100 le 1 est de poids 3 (2^3)=8
.
en codage sur 16 bits (2 octets) on parle aussi de l'octet de poids fort (les 8 bits les plus significatifs de 9 à 16).
quand aux entiers signés (avec le 1 devant) il est important de parler aussi sur combien de bits ils sont stokés et aussi le système : signé, complement à 1 ou complement à 2.
au niveau du stokage des nombres on peut aussi envisager le DCB enfin vous voyez rien n'est simple et les méthodes sont nombreuseuses.
je vous renvoie à internet pour dévellopper !!!
etv de grace 0.111 ne veut rien dire pas de point
est donné par la position du bit en partant de la droite
par exemple dans 00000100 le 1 est de poids 3 (2^3)=8
.
en codage sur 16 bits (2 octets) on parle aussi de l'octet de poids fort (les 8 bits les plus significatifs de 9 à 16).
quand aux entiers signés (avec le 1 devant) il est important de parler aussi sur combien de bits ils sont stokés et aussi le système : signé, complement à 1 ou complement à 2.
au niveau du stokage des nombres on peut aussi envisager le DCB enfin vous voyez rien n'est simple et les méthodes sont nombreuseuses.
je vous renvoie à internet pour dévellopper !!!
etv de grace 0.111 ne veut rien dire pas de point
-
charognard
Niveau 10: GR (Guide de Référence)- Posts: 869
- Joined: 18 Oct 2007, 00:00
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: sans
Re: Décimaux en hexadécimale
charognard wrote:etv de grace 0.111 ne veut rien dire pas de point
?
`echo "ZWNobyAncm0gLXJmIC4gaGFoYWhhIDpEJwo=" | base64 -d`
Pas de support par MP, merci.
Pas de support par MP, merci.
-
tama
Niveau 14: CI (Calculateur de l'Infini)- Posts: 10995
- Joined: 19 Dec 2005, 00:00
- Location: /dev/null mais je survis :)
- Gender:
- Calculator(s):→ MyCalcs profile
Re: Décimaux en hexadécimale
tama wrote:charognard wrote:etv de grace 0.111 ne veut rien dire pas de point
?
Je crois qu'il veut dire que puisque nous sommes français, nous devrions écrire 0,111 pour désigner 111 x 10^(-3).

-
Maréchal FlaK
Niveau 8: ER (Espèce Rare: nerd)- Posts: 210
- Joined: 26 Jan 2007, 00:00
- Location: Ici (comme ça, tu sais!)
- Gender:
- Calculator(s):→ MyCalcs profile
- Class: Terminale S, Anglais/Espagnol, Spécialité Mathématiques, Option Latin.
31 posts
• Page 2 of 4 • 1, 2, 3, 4
Who is online
Users browsing this forum: ClaudeBot [spider] and 8 guests